Today’s Guest: Geraldine McGinty, MD | Board Chair, American College of Radiology & Chief Strategy Officer for the Weill Cornell Physician’s Organization
Host Greg Matthews and Dr Geraldine McGinty, The chair of the American College of Radiology’s Board of Chancellors, talk about why Radiology has been existentially linked with technological innovation since its inception, and how it will lead us into a future of technolog-enabled “Integrated Diagnostics” combining the disciplines of Radiology, Pathology and Genomics.
